Private international law addresses disputes involving foreign elements and helps determine:
Which jurisdiction’s courts may hear a case
Which country’s law should apply
How foreign judgments are recognized or enforced in Pakistan and elsewhere

Private international law cases involve cross-border legal challenges between individuals or corporations. These include:
Determining whether Pakistani or foreign courts have jurisdiction
Transnational family, commercial, and tort claims
Applying correct legal systems in cross-border contracts, torts, property, or marriage issues
Use of “connecting factors” such as:
Lex loci contractus (place of contract)
Lex domicilii (domicile)
Lex situs (location of property)
We help enforce foreign judgments and arbitral awards in Pakistan or challenge them on grounds such as:
Lack of jurisdiction
Public policy violations
Fraud or procedural injustice
